构建数据库的步骤是什么

fiy 其他 102

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    构建数据库是一个复杂的过程,需要经过以下步骤:

    1. 确定需求:在构建数据库之前,首先需要明确数据库的目标和需求。这包括确定需要存储的数据类型、数据量、访问频率等。根据需求,可以确定数据库的结构和功能。

    2. 设计数据库模式:数据库模式是数据库的逻辑结构,它定义了数据的组织方式和关系。在设计数据库模式时,需要根据需求确定实体(Entity)、属性(Attribute)和关系(Relationship)。可以使用实体关系模型(ER模型)来表示数据库模式。

    3. 选择数据库管理系统(DBMS):根据需求和设计的数据库模式,选择合适的数据库管理系统。常见的DBMS包括MySQL、Oracle、SQL Server等。选择DBMS时,需要考虑性能、可靠性、安全性和可扩展性等因素。

    4. 创建数据库和表结构:在选择了合适的DBMS之后,需要使用DBMS提供的工具或语言(如SQL)来创建数据库和表结构。在创建表结构时,需要定义表的字段、数据类型、约束条件等。还可以创建索引、视图、触发器等来提高数据库的性能和灵活性。

    5. 导入数据:在数据库和表结构创建完毕后,可以导入数据到数据库中。数据可以来自文件、其他数据库或者通过应用程序生成。导入数据时,需要保证数据的完整性和一致性。

    6. 设计和实现查询功能:数据库的主要功能之一是查询数据。在构建数据库时,需要根据需求设计和实现查询功能。这包括编写SQL查询语句、创建视图、定义存储过程等。

    7. 进行性能优化:在数据库构建完成后,需要进行性能优化。这包括优化查询语句、创建合适的索引、调整数据库参数等。通过性能优化可以提高数据库的响应速度和处理能力。

    8. 定期备份和维护:构建数据库之后,需要定期进行备份和维护工作。备份可以保护数据免受意外损失,维护可以保证数据库的稳定性和性能。备份和维护可以通过DBMS提供的工具或脚本来完成。

    总之,构建数据库是一个复杂的过程,需要经过需求确定、设计数据库模式、选择DBMS、创建数据库和表结构、导入数据、设计和实现查询功能、性能优化以及定期备份和维护等步骤。这些步骤需要仔细规划和执行,以确保数据库的稳定性和性能。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    构建数据库是一个系统性的过程,一般包括以下几个步骤:

    1. 需求分析:首先,需要明确数据库的需求和目标,包括数据的类型、数量、访问频率、安全性等方面的要求。这一步骤需要与相关的用户和利益相关方沟通,以确保数据库能够满足他们的需求。

    2. 数据设计:在需求分析的基础上,进行数据库的逻辑设计。这包括确定数据模型(如关系模型、层次模型、网络模型等)、实体关系图的设计、属性的定义等。在设计过程中,需要考虑数据的完整性、一致性和可扩展性。

    3. 物理设计:在逻辑设计的基础上,进行数据库的物理设计。这包括确定数据库的存储结构、索引的设计、分区的策略等。物理设计的目标是提高数据库的性能和可用性。

    4. 数据库建立:在物理设计完成后,需要根据设计的结果建立数据库。这包括创建数据库、表、视图、索引等对象,以及定义数据类型、约束、触发器等。

    5. 数据导入:在数据库建立完成后,需要将现有的数据导入到数据库中。这包括将数据从原始数据源中提取出来,并按照数据库的结构进行转换和加载。

    6. 数据库测试:在数据导入完成后,需要进行数据库的测试,以验证数据库的功能和性能是否符合需求。测试的内容包括功能测试、性能测试、安全性测试等。

    7. 数据库运维:在数据库建立和测试完成后,需要进行数据库的运维工作,包括备份和恢复、性能监控和优化、安全管理等。这些工作是数据库的持续运行和稳定性的保障。

    总结:构建数据库是一个复杂的过程,需要经过需求分析、数据设计、物理设计、数据库建立、数据导入、数据库测试和数据库运维等多个步骤。每个步骤都需要仔细考虑和实施,以确保数据库能够满足用户的需求,并保持高性能和可用性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    构建数据库是指在计算机系统中建立一个用于存储和管理数据的数据库。构建数据库的步骤可以大致分为以下几个:

    1. 需求分析:确定数据库的目标和需求,包括数据的类型、数量、访问模式等。在这一阶段,需要与用户和相关利益相关方进行充分的沟通和需求收集,以确保数据库的设计满足实际需求。

    2. 数据库设计:根据需求分析的结果,设计数据库的逻辑结构和物理结构。逻辑结构包括实体-关系模型和关系模型的规范化设计,物理结构包括表空间、数据文件、索引等的设计。

    3. 数据库创建:根据数据库设计的结果,在数据库管理系统(DBMS)中创建数据库。这包括创建数据库实例、表空间、数据文件、表、索引等。

    4. 数据库初始化:对数据库进行初始化设置,包括设置参数、权限管理等。这些设置将影响数据库的性能、安全性和可靠性。

    5. 数据导入:将现有的数据导入数据库中。这可以通过导入工具、脚本等方式进行。在导入数据之前,需要先创建表的结构,然后将数据按照表结构进行导入。

    6. 数据库优化:对数据库进行性能优化,包括调整参数、优化查询语句、创建索引等。通过优化可以提高数据库的响应速度和数据访问效率。

    7. 数据库备份与恢复:设置数据库的备份策略,并定期对数据库进行备份。在数据库出现故障或数据丢失的情况下,可以通过备份文件进行数据恢复。

    8. 数据库维护:定期对数据库进行维护工作,包括数据清理、空间管理、性能监控等。这有助于保持数据库的正常运行和数据的完整性。

    需要注意的是,构建数据库是一个迭代的过程,需要不断进行需求分析、设计、实施和优化等步骤,以满足不断变化的业务需求和技术要求。同时,数据库的构建也需要根据具体的数据库管理系统(如Oracle、MySQL、SQL Server等)来进行相应的操作和配置。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部